OvenCavityOperationalStateTrait

@Generated(value = ["GoogleHomePlatformCodegen"])
object OvenCavityOperationalStateTrait


Attributes for OvenCavityOperationalStateTrait.

Summary

Nested types

@Generated(value = ["GoogleHomePlatformCodegen"])
interface OvenCavityOperationalStateTrait.Attributes : ClusterStruct

Attributes for the OvenCavityOperationalState cluster.

The error states.

Used to indicate the error state of the oven when the OvenCavityOperationalState.Attributes.operationalState attribute is Error.

Descriptor enum for this struct's fields.

This event is generated when the overall operation ends, successfully or otherwise.

This event is generated when a reportable error condition is detected.

The operational states.

Used to indicate a possible state of the oven.

Descriptor enum for this struct's fields.

Start the oven if it is in a state where it can be started.

The request payload for the Start command.

Descriptor enum for this command's request fields.

The result of the completed Start command.

Descriptor enum for this command's request fields.

Stop the oven if possible, based on the current operation underway.

The request payload for the Stop command.

Descriptor enum for this command's request fields.

The result of the completed Stop command.

Descriptor enum for this command's request fields.

Public properties

ClusterId

Public properties

Id

val IdClusterId